LAPP Control Cable, Braided Copper Wire, 250V Voltage Rating - UNITRONIC Series - 0034306


Make connections in your low-frequency system with this 6-core LiYCY control cable from LAPP. It's a long-lasting component thanks to its tinned copper braid, which is resistant to both oxidation and corrosion. This also helps it maintain signal strength even in damp environments. Further protecting your setup is the PVC sheath that's flame-retardant to minimise the risk of an electrical fire. Use this cable to transmit data between computers or control and measuring devices.

Why should I choose cables with braided copper wires?


Braided copper wire minimises EMI that could otherwise interrupt signals in your system.
